In this episode, Geoff Wilson and Guy Thompson virtually explore the nefarious design choices that give shopping malls their shape.
Want to give your subconscious a fighting chance against the onslaught of eye candy lining the storefronts? We might just have the tip to help you be a more intentional consumer.
Covered in this episode:
💡 Why are malls designed to make us forget?
💡 How does a “Gruen transfer” make us more susceptible to impulse buying?
💡 What can technology do to improve physical wayfinding?
💡 Will online fulfilment radically change the shopping experience in a good way?
💡 Are malls really dying?Originally recorded on 7 August 2021.
